The Lead Patient Procedure Scheduler reflects the mission, vision, and values of Northwestern Memorial,adheres to the organization’s Code of Ethics and Corporate Compliance Program, and complies with all relevantpolicies, procedures, guidelines and all other regulatory and accreditation standards.
The Lead Patient Procedure Scheduler is primarily responsible for scheduling surgical and pre-operative procedures and maintaining schedules related to these procedures. Scheduling includes registration, verifying insurance information, obtaining pre-certifications,and instructing patients on appropriate procedures. This role may also be cross-trained and utilized as a Patient Service Representative, thereby assuming the responsibilities associated with the check-in/out functions, or as a Patient Liaison, thereby assuming the responsibilities associated with provider templates and patient correspondence.
Responsibilities
- Registers and schedules patients for surgical and pre-operative procedures.
- Inform patients of their financial responsibilities.
- Provide patients with surgical and procedural information and instructions as appropriate.
- Obtains and/or facilitates pre-certification as required.
- Maintains calendars and schedules related to surgical and pre-operative procedures.
- Answers all incoming patient inquiries.
- May perform other duties as assigned.
- Leads the work of schedulers within the practice.
- Serves as a role model and resource to staff.
- Provides training and orienting to all new hires, and maintains training and orientation materials andrecords.
- Monitors and evaluates policies and procedures to suggest operational changes.
- Schedule staff and allocate resources across hours of operation to maximize patient access andsatisfaction, provider productivity and efficiency, and staff productivity.
- Conduct office meetings with the schedulers to go over safety, training updates and workflowchanges.
- Attend and actively participate in leadership meetings with the Practice Administrator and AOC.
- Monitor productivity by running productivity reports from Calabrio One
- Monitor the abandonment rate of incoming calls with access to Cisco Unified Intelligence Center
- May perform other duties as assigned.
- Position will be able to work from home with days in the office as the business needs demand.
